Working my way through “Art and Fear”

One of my favorite art books is Art and Fear: Observations on the Perils (and Rewards) of Artmaking (David  Bayles, Ted Orland). It is not a how-to book, nor is a book about inspiration. It is about the work of making art. It explores the process of making art and why it doesn’t get made. And…
